Conversation with Pam

Posted 03-10-2008 at 05:06 PM by ladychief231
My good friend Pam had WLS in May 07 and has lost over 100 pounds. She has been advocating this surgery for me since she has had it done. She was/is diabetic and was resistant to insulin and she had severe sleep apnea. Since the surgery she takes only one insulin injection and no longer uses a cpap.

Everytime we speak I ask her a million questions about her experience and about what she eats on a daily basis. This past weekend we spoke a long time about what to expect at the pre-admission testing and the first month following the surgery. I wish she would have journaled her experience as I am because she already forgets some details that I would find helpful. Anyway, we laughed and laughed at her description of her first poop following the surgery. She described her poop looking like minature hershey kisses. Can you imagine?

Pam is coming to spend the weekend following my surgery to help my partner and I with our three dogs and to offer support to both of us. She is also saving tons of clothing for me in all sizes as she has gone from a size 24 to a size 10. Have I mentioned that she looks and feels great? She says she feels like she has a second chance at life. We are so looking forward to resuming our long distant bike riding that we used to do many many years ago.

Thank you Pam for your support and patience with me as I take the steps to my new life.
